Just 1.3 miles off the Atlantic City Expressway, Unity Place of Atlantic County offers partial care and outpatient programs for adults with mental health, substance use, or co-occurring disorders. The center supports recovery through personalized schedules, transportation, and daily meals, making it easier to attend. Services are Medicaid and insurance-friendly, helping clients take the next step toward long-term wellness.
Clients receive a blend of evidence-based care and supportive therapies, including c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), psychiatric services, medication education, and trauma-focused groups. The program empowers participants to choose from activities that match their needs, including stress management, relapse prevention, and skill-building. Group and individual sessions focus on healing both mind and body with a team-based, person-centered approach.
Specialty groups foster growth through 12-Step recovery, anger management certification, grief support, and creative expression. Case managers help with social services, legal support, and vocational planning. On-site lab work and medication management support mental health stabilization. With daily meals, reliable transportation, and connections to drug court advocacy, Unity Place offers the structure and care people need to recover and thrive.
